OverviewTextile manufacturing refers to the process of converting cotton, silk, jute, etc. into fabric to be used for clothes. The process primarily starts with knitting and weaving. Some other forms are braiding, plaiting, and bonding of fibers. The most common types of textiles manufactured around the world are linen, wool, cashmere, velvet, rayon, denim, etc. This book is a compilation of chapters that discuss the most vital concepts in the field of textile manufacturing.
